Subject: [PULL 06/11] qemu-options: Remove the deprecated -async-teardown option
Date: Fri, 19 Jan 2024 16:25:02 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240119152507.55182-7-thuth@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240119152507.55182-1-thuth@redhat.com>

It's been marked as deprecated since QEMU 8.1 (and was only available
since QEMU 8.0 anyway), so it should be fine to remove this now.

Reviewed-by: Claudio Imbrenda <imbrenda@linux.ibm.com>
Reviewed-by: Markus Armbruster <armbru@redhat.com>
Message-ID: <20240118103759.130748-4-thuth@redhat.com>
Signed-off-by: Thomas Huth <thuth@redhat.com>
---
 docs/about/deprecated.rst       |  5 -----
 docs/about/removed-features.rst |  5 +++++
 system/vl.c                     |  6 ------
 qemu-options.hx                 | 10 ----------
 4 files changed, 5 insertions(+), 21 deletions(-)

diff --git a/docs/about/deprecated.rst b/docs/about/deprecated.rst
index aa2cbe0d74..1c92a17896 100644
--- a/docs/about/deprecated.rst
+++ b/docs/about/deprecated.rst
@@ -63,11 +63,6 @@ as short-form boolean values, and passed to plugins as ``arg_name=on``.
 However, short-form booleans are deprecated and full explicit ``arg_name=on``
 form is preferred.
 
-``-async-teardown`` (since 8.1)
-'''''''''''''''''''''''''''''''
-
-Use ``-run-with async-teardown=on`` instead.
-
 ``-chroot`` (since 8.1)
 '''''''''''''''''''''''
 
diff --git a/docs/about/removed-features.rst b/docs/about/removed-features.rst
index ae728b6130..43f64a26ba 100644
--- a/docs/about/removed-features.rst
+++ b/docs/about/removed-features.rst
@@ -472,6 +472,11 @@ Use ``-machine hpet=off`` instead.
 The ``-no-acpi`` setting has been turned into a machine property.
 Use ``-machine acpi=off`` instead.
 
+``-async-teardown`` (removed in 9.0)
+''''''''''''''''''''''''''''''''''''
+
+Use ``-run-with async-teardown=on`` instead.
+
 
 QEMU Machine Protocol (QMP) commands
 ------------------------------------
diff --git a/system/vl.c b/system/vl.c
index 7e258889f3..924356f864 100644
--- a/system/vl.c
+++ b/system/vl.c
@@ -3600,12 +3600,6 @@ void qemu_init(int argc, char **argv)
             case QEMU_OPTION_daemonize:
                 os_set_daemonize(true);
                 break;
-#if defined(CONFIG_LINUX)
-            /* deprecated */
-            case QEMU_OPTION_asyncteardown:
-                init_async_teardown();
-                break;
-#endif
             case QEMU_OPTION_run_with: {
                 const char *str;
                 opts = qemu_opts_parse_noisily(qemu_find_opts("run-with"),
diff --git a/qemu-options.hx b/qemu-options.hx
index 844a189fb0..8299f5cc0f 100644
--- a/qemu-options.hx
+++ b/qemu-options.hx
@@ -4977,16 +4977,6 @@ HXCOMM Internal use
 DEF("qtest", HAS_ARG, QEMU_OPTION_qtest, "", QEMU_ARCH_ALL)
 DEF("qtest-log", HAS_ARG, QEMU_OPTION_qtest_log, "", QEMU_ARCH_ALL)
 
-#ifdef __linux__
-DEF("async-teardown", 0, QEMU_OPTION_asyncteardown,
-    "-async-teardown enable asynchronous teardown\n",
-    QEMU_ARCH_ALL)
-SRST
-``-async-teardown``
-    This option is deprecated and should no longer be used. The new option
-    ``-run-with async-teardown=on`` is a replacement.
-ERST
-#endif
 #ifdef CONFIG_POSIX
 DEF("run-with", HAS_ARG, QEMU_OPTION_run_with,
     "-run-with [async-teardown=on|off][,chroot=dir]\n"
